A maiden in Persian-style dress, playing a stringed musical instrument, seated on a garden terrace
Deccan, late 17th/early 18th Century

gouache and gold on paper, gold margin, laid down on later paper
painting 163 x 117 mm.

While there are strong Persian elements to the maiden's dress (notably the boots), it may also be seen as an interpretation of European 17th Century clothing: compare a painting of a maiden with a wine bottle and cup, in a similar hat, cape and boots in the British Museum, dated to the 18th Century (once part of an album, inv. no. 1920, 0917,0.13).
